Altimeter Group Expands With Addition of Industry Veterans
SAN MATEO, CA--(eMediaWorld - August 27, 2009) - Altimeter Group, a consulting firm focused on helping businesses integrate emerging technologies into their strategies, today announced the addition of three partners to meet the demands of the growing firm. Internet pioneer Deborah Schultz, and former Forrester Research analysts R "Ray" Wang and Jeremiah Owyang join Charlene Li, founding partner of Altimeter Group, in the firm's San Mateo, Calif., headquarters. As part of the firm's expansion, Altimeter Group also announced the launch of "The Hanger," a physical space intended to bring together the ecosystem of emerging technologies, thought leaders, business and service providers to innovate and bring new ideas to life.
Altimeter Group's Partner Profiles
Deborah Schultz leads Altimeter's Innovation and Best Practices business focused on bringing together the ecosystem of emerging technologies including investors, start-ups, businesses, end users, service providers, and thought leaders for experimentation, active learning and real-world application. Most recently, she architected the Procter & Gamble Social Media Lab to study the impact of the social web on customer relationships and the business benefits of "open innovation." She continues as a member of P&G's Digital Advisory Board. Previously, Schultz was the Marketing Director at Six Apart.
Former Forrester Research analyst R "Ray" Wang joins Altimeter Group to lead the Enterprise Strategy practice with a focus on actionable application strategies that bridge the emerging world of Web 2.0 and Enterprise 2.0 business solutions with today's enterprise technologies. Wang brings profound experience, providing enterprise strategy and contract negotiations expertise to some of the world's leading organizations. His achievements have been recognized by the Institute of Industry Analyst Relations, which named Wang "Analyst of the Year" in both 2008 and 2009. Wang also brings experience gained from his posts with PeopleSoft, Oracle, Personify, Deloitte, and Ernst & Young.
Jeremiah Owyang will lead Altimeter's Customer Strategy practice. Jeremiah brings more than a decade of experience counseling companies on how to leverage emerging technologies to communicate with customers. Previously, he was the online community manager at Hitachi Data Systems and director of corporate strategy at PodTech. Owyang joins Altimeter Group from Forrester Research where he advised and created research for interactive marketers.

The Hanger at Altimeter Group
At The Hanger, Altimeter Group will host community events, training, and "unconferences" that provide experimentation, learning, and sharing around emerging technologies.

About Altimeter Group
Altimeter Group, founded by Charlene Li, co-author of the bestselling book "Groundswell: Winning In A World Transformed by Social Technologies," provides strategic advice on how companies can tap into emerging technologies to address pressing business issues. A combination of real-time research, hands-on experimentation, and industry relationships gives Altimeter Group the insight to address client challenges with a holistic approach. The firm's strategic areas include Enterprise Strategy, Customer Strategy, Innovation and Best Practices, and Leadership and Management. More information can be found at www.altimetergroup.com.
